易语言资源网 - 做最全的易语言资源下载社区
精易论坛授权登录

类_JavaScriptTools模块开源   [复制链接]

    2020-11-25 08:33:16
    2020开源大赛(第五届)
    易语言资源网
    2028 次浏览
    来源链接

写模块的目的是为了更方便的去编写JS调试工具

刚好打算开源的,顺便就发在大赛里面了

模块功能介绍

1.execJs                     执行JS代码,执行失败会返回错误信息,相当于JS调试工具中的 加载代码

2.getProcedures         获取所有的函数,相当于JS中加载代码后 获取所有的函数,方便调用

3.eval                         运行JS代码,相当于JS调试工具中的系统运行

4.getErrorInfo            当 execJs eval  evalObj 返回失败的时候,可以获取错误信息

5.getCodeObject       获取代码对象,也就是加载的整个JS对象

6.evalObj                  通过代码对象执行函数,详情参照 <JavsScriptTools演示.e> 中的源码

7.getThis                  获取整个脚本对象,方便扩展命令

8.reset                     清除加载的JS对象,但不销毁




点我下载 (已有 173 次下载)

引用模块


源码文件名 模块文件名
JavsScriptTools演示.e
类_JavaScriptTools.ec


引用支持库


源码文件名 支持库文件名 支持库标识
JavsScriptTools演示.e 系统核心支持库 5.7 d09f2340818511d396f6aaf844c7e325
类_JavaScriptTools.e 系统核心支持库 5.7 d09f2340818511d396f6aaf844c7e325
特殊功能支持库 3.1 A512548E76954B6E92C21055517615B0


[错误报告]   上一篇:英文学习笔记,带语音...     下一篇:TX云录音文件识别例子(V3签名算法)...